Math-A-Thons and Math Bees are academic competitions with math. You need to do it by grade levels, and it can be done with powerpoint presentations or questions read on cards. Students can do it as a team or individually dpending on what your team decides.
Teachers need to assist in the classroom, practices need to be held for students competing, and trophies, medals, ribbons, or certificates are appropriate prizes.
The Math Bee can be more for the individual and the Math-A-Thon (this is done over a period of time) can be more of a team thing.
